141 trees planted at River Loop Park
The City of Eugene recently planted 141 trees at River Loop Natural Park. The park is located at 1800 River Loop 1. The trees are a mix of White Alder, Suksdorf’s hawthorn, Western crabapple, Black cottonwood, Choke cherry, Cascara, and … Continue reading

Great News! – Phase 1 of Santa Clara Community Park to begin in March
Construction will begin soon for the City of Eugene Parks and Open Space’s new community park along River Loop 2! The work will include construction of an accessible playground, picnic shelter, spray playground, sand playground, parking lot, and restroom. Construction will … Continue reading
